Which brings me to a question.
I've been doing the stairmaster 6/7 days a week for about 3 weeks, on a low level (because I'm so out of shape). Is it more important to add to the time, while keeping the level the same, or increase the level, while doing the same time?
I have increased the time, but kept the level... I was just curious.
I'm no authority, but almost everything I read these days seems to indicate that increasing intensity will probably give you more benefits than increasing length. From heart rate interval training to this Sprint 8 workout, most of the gurus seem to be pushing towards increasing intensity (even if only in short bursts).
